Safety is the cornerstone of the construction industry. With increasing urbanization and infrastructural development worldwide, the demand for protective gear, especially construction safety helmets, has seen significant growth. These helmets are not just protective equipment but have become an essential part of workplace safety compliance, reducing the risk of injuries caused by falling objects, electrical hazards, and accidental impacts.
Market Overview
The Construction Safety Helmets Market is witnessing steady growth due to the rising emphasis on worker safety and stringent government regulations. Construction companies are increasingly investing in personal protective equipment (PPE) to protect their workforce. This trend is further driven by growing awareness among laborers about occupational hazards and the importance of wearing safety helmets at construction sites.
In addition, the construction industry’s expansion in emerging economies, coupled with large-scale infrastructure projects, has contributed to a surge in demand for high-quality safety helmets. With advancements in materials and manufacturing technologies, modern helmets are lighter, more durable, and comfortable, which encourages consistent usage.
Key Drivers of Market Growth
Several factors are driving the Construction Safety Helmets Market forward:
- Rising Construction Activities: Rapid urbanization and infrastructural development have increased the number of construction sites globally. This expansion necessitates enhanced safety measures, including helmets.
- Government Regulations and Standards: Regulatory authorities worldwide mandate the use of helmets for construction workers, ensuring compliance with safety standards. These regulations drive consistent demand for certified helmets.
- Technological Advancements: Modern construction helmets are designed with advanced features like impact resistance, ventilation, adjustable straps, and even integrated communication systems, increasing their adoption.
- Awareness Campaigns: Initiatives by construction associations and safety organizations to educate workers about the benefits of using helmets have further boosted market demand.
Market Segmentation
The Construction Safety Helmets Market can be segmented based on material, type, and application:
- Material: Helmets are commonly made from high-density polyethylene (HDPE), acrylonitrile butadiene styrene (ABS), and fiberglass. HDPE helmets dominate the market due to their lightweight and robust properties.
- Type: Helmets can be classified as standard safety helmets, full-brim helmets, and Vented helmets. Each type caters to different working conditions and safety requirements.
- Application: Construction safety helmets find applications in commercial construction, residential projects, and industrial infrastructure. Commercial construction remains the largest segment due to large-scale projects requiring strict safety protocols.
Regional Insights
North America and Europe are mature markets for construction safety helmets due to stringent safety regulations and advanced construction infrastructure. Meanwhile, Asia-Pacific is expected to witness the highest growth, driven by rapid urbanization, government-led infrastructure projects, and increasing awareness of worker safety. Countries such as China, India, and Southeast Asian nations are significant contributors to the market expansion in this region.
Future Outlook
The future of the Construction Safety Helmets Market looks promising, with a focus on innovation and sustainability. Helmets integrated with smart technology, such as sensors to detect impact, fatigue monitoring, and augmented reality (AR) capabilities, are gaining traction. Additionally, the trend toward eco-friendly materials and reusable designs aligns with the growing sustainability initiatives in the construction sector.
Market players are also focusing on product customization to meet the specific needs of various construction projects, enhancing user comfort and safety. As construction projects become more complex and safety regulations more stringent, the adoption of high-quality safety helmets will continue to rise.
